Dhelkaya Health is a new health service on Dja Dja Wurrung country; it is the coming together of Castlemaine Health, Maldon Hospital and CHIRP Community Health. ‘Dhelkaya’ means ‘being healthy’ in the Dja Dja Wurrung language. The origins of our name are closely tied to our region’s history, its people and country. Dhelkaya Health is shaping a better health system for the people of Mount Alexander Shire and beyond, while staying true and local in everything it does. Dhelkaya Health delivers a diverse range of inpatient, outpatient, aged care, community health and outreach services to Mount Alexander Shire. It also delivers assessment, rehabilitation and allied health services to neighbouring shires. Dhelkaya Health is committed to the quality, accessibility and sustainability of acute, aged and community-based healthcare, and family and housing services. Dhelkaya Health has campuses in Castlemaine and Maldon.
